Seabourn Cruise Line is an ultra-luxury cruise company renowned for providing unparalleled experiences and personalized service to discerning travelers. With a focus on intimacy, elegance, and exceptional attention to detail, Seabourn offers a refined and intimate journey to some of the most exquisite destinations around the world.
Seabourn's fleet consists of small, intimate ships designed to provide an exclusive and immersive experience. With spacious all-suite accommodations, elegantly appointed public spaces, and world-class amenities, guests are treated to the utmost comfort and luxury throughout their voyage. The ships' intimate size allows for access to smaller ports and hidden gems, creating unique itineraries that go beyond the typical cruise experience.
What sets Seabourn apart is their commitment to personalized service. The attentive and highly trained staff anticipates guests' every need, ensuring a seamless and pampering experience from the moment of embarkation. Whether it's providing a customized dining experience, arranging private shore excursions, or offering personalized spa treatments, Seabourn's crew is dedicated to exceeding expectations and creating unforgettable moments.
Seabourn's itineraries encompass a wide range of destinations, from iconic cultural capitals to secluded and exotic locales. From the pristine beaches of the Caribbean to the majestic fjords of Norway, from the ancient ruins of the Mediterranean to the wildlife-rich landscapes of Antarctica, each voyage is thoughtfully curated to offer a blend of exploration, enrichment, and relaxation.
Culinary excellence is a hallmark of Seabourn, with gourmet dining experiences created by world-class chefs. The ships offer a variety of dining venues, ranging from elegant main restaurants to specialty dining options that showcase regional flavors and innovative culinary creations. Guests can indulge in exquisite cuisine paired with fine wines and enjoy attentive service in an intimate and elegant setting.
Seabourn is committed to responsible and sustainable travel practices. They strive to minimize their environmental impact, support local communities, and contribute to the preservation of the pristine destinations they visit.
For travelers seeking an extraordinary and intimate luxury cruise experience, Seabourn Cruise Line offers a refined and personalized journey, combining exquisite accommodations, exceptional service, and captivating destinations for a truly unforgettable vacation.
